Driving Assistance and Accident Monitoring Using Three Axis Accelerometer and GPS System
Roma Goregaonkar | Snehal Bhosale [3]
Abstract: While travelling on highway we are unaware of the road conditions. Mobile phones today are equipped with inbuilt sensors that give safety enhancement to the drivers on road. The three axis accelerometer and a GPS tracking system of smart phone can give assistance to the driver while travelling. In this paper the emphasis is on safety with advanced driver assistance system (ADASs). The three axis accelerometer of an Android based smart phone is used to record and analyze various and external road conditions that could be hazardous to the health of the driver and the automobile. With analysis and alerts of these factors; we can increase a drivers overall awareness to maximize safety. Google map is used to create road condition using GPS coordinates. Android operating system in smart phone is used for analyzing the road conditions for safety. Once the data is available to the user; he can efficiently and safely drive the vehicle. In addition a device similar to black box is kept in a vehicle that monitors if the accidents occur. This device consists of GPS; collision sensor as a switch; GSM and a microcontroller unit. This device will send a message to the concerned person about the event of the accident.
